Douthitt Objects to Union Stand on Sullivan Franchise

W T Douthitt attorney for Indiana Coal Belt Traction Co writes to the Union urging publication of the full ordinance and arguing the board should grant a franchise only after proven intent to build. He contends opposition blocks interurban plans to connect Sullivan with Linton and mining towns, while the Union insists a 50 year grant is too generous and that the town should not be bound to one line.

Allan Hughes Dead A Pioneer And County Resident

Thomas Allen Hughes a pioneer of the county and one of its oldest residents died Monday at his home at age 82. He helped build the first Sullivan court house and was an early deputy auditor after the county seat moved to the city. An 149th Indiana Volunteer, he served in the Civil War and helped organize Home Guards. Survived by wife Sarah J Mahan and five children, funeral today from Cross street residence with G A R and D A R attendance. Burial at Center Ridge.

Sullivan's New Well at the Water Works

Sullivan's new well at the water works is finished and a final test will be made this week. A fine vein of water is found in the gravel at 70 feet. The well should supply the town with adequate water for present needs, though another well may be required if demand rises.

Widow Mrs Lizzie Anderson Dies After Illness

Mrs Lizzie Anderson widow of the late Jacob Anderson died Tuesday morning at her home after an extended illness of general debility. Born July 30 1852 in Vigo county she was the daughter of the late William H Martin and a Christian church member. She leaves a daughter Miss Ola Anderson three brothers and two sisters. The funeral will be held at the residence tomorrow with burial at Liberty.
